Why Tinubu Can Not Solve Wike–Fubara Crisis–Pastor David Ibiyeomie
Pastor David Ibiyeomie, the founder of Salvation Ministries has stated that president Bola Ahmed Tinubu does not have the solution to the ongoing political crisis in Rivers state between governor Sim Fubara and former governor Nyesom Wike.
Pastor Ibiyeomie while speaking today at the day 4 of the Glory Reign Service attended by governor Sim Fubara, stated that the Rivers state political crisis can not be resolved through the intervention of anybody no matter how highly placed or powerful the person is.
According to him, the political crisis in Rivers state is a long-standing pattern which can only be solved by divine intervention. He claims that the crisis has spiritual undertone and defies every physical solutions.
He pointed out that political crisis between incumbent governor of Rivers state and his predecessor has become a tradition in the state.
He added that even if governor Sim Fubara who was at the program, decides to choose his successor, he will also have crisis with his successor.
“No mortal man can solve the political crisis in Rivers State. Has the president been able to solve it ? All Rivers governors have fought with their predecessors. It’s not a physical problem. If Fubara picks someone as his successor, the person will fight him. It’s a spiritual problem. They’ve tried all means, even the President has not been able to solve it”, he stated.
